Familiaris Consortio: Rediscovering the Mission of the Christian Family in the Modern World
In a world marked by rapid change, uncertainty, and shifting values, the role of the family has never been more important—or more challenged. Many households today struggle to remain united, to transmit faith, and to find meaning amid the pressures of modern life. It is precisely in this context that Familiaris Consortio, inspired by the apostolic exhortation of Pope John Paul II, emerges as a powerful and timely guide for those seeking clarity, direction, and hope.
At its core, Familiaris Consortio reminds us that the family is not an accident of history, but part of God’s divine plan. It is within the home that love is first experienced, where values are formed, and where the seeds of faith are planted. In a time when many question the relevance of traditional family structures, this message becomes not only relevant but urgent.
The book thoughtfully addresses the real challenges families face today—cultural shifts, moral confusion, economic pressures, and the constant distractions of modern life. Rather than ignoring these difficulties, it confronts them with wisdom, offering both theological depth and practical solutions. It encourages families to remain rooted in truth while adapting with discernment and courage.
One of the most compelling aspects of this work is its balance between reflection and action. It does not remain in abstract ideas but provides clear principles for strengthening family bonds, fostering unity, and living the Christian faith in everyday situations. From communication and forgiveness to prayer and responsibility, it outlines a path that is both realistic and transformative.
For couples, this book becomes a guide to rediscover the beauty of their vocation. For parents, it offers direction in raising children with faith and purpose. For pastoral leaders, it serves as a foundational resource to support and guide families in their communities. And for anyone seeking deeper understanding, it opens a new vision of the family’s central role in the renewal of the Church and society.
In a culture that often undervalues commitment and sacrifice, Familiaris Consortio presents a different perspective—one that sees the family as a place of holiness, growth, and mission. It challenges readers to move beyond mediocrity and to embrace a higher calling: building a home grounded in love, truth, and faith.
Perhaps the greatest message of this work is this: the future of humanity passes through the family. Strengthening families is not just a personal matter—it is a mission that impacts the entire world.
